50.29688, -3.80849Overlooking the garden, Home Farm Churchstow hotel is located about 10 minutes' drive from Harbour House. Parking is available on site at this bed & breakfast.
Location
Situated 2.5 miles from South Devon Area Of Outstanding Natural Beauty, the recently renovated hotel also gives access to such sports venues as Thurlestone Golf Club, which is approximately 10 minutes' drive away. Totnes is 12 miles from the Churchstow property, while St Mary's Church is around 5 minutes' walk away. No matter the religion, travelers prefer to visit Kingsbridge Evangelical Church, a popular place of worship located around a 10-minute drive from this Churchstow hotel.
For those traveling from afar, Exeter International airport is 56 minutes' drive away.
